vmess协议安全性分析与使用指南

1. 引言

在当今的信息技术时代,互联网的安全性变得尤为重要,尤其是随着对隐私保护和数据安全性要求的提高。近来,vmess协议作为一种新兴的网络协议,引起了广泛的关注。本文将深入探讨vmess协议的安全性及其在实际应用中的表现。

2. 什么是vmess协议

vmess协议是V2Ray项目中的一种多路复用的网络协议,它以一种灵活可靠的方式传输数据。其主要特点包括:

  • 数据加密:支持多种加密方式,确保数据在传输过程中的安全性。
  • 多路复用:可以同时传输多个请求,提高了数据传输的效率。
  • 伪装性:通过混淆数据流,使得流量更难以被监测和分析。

3. vmess协议的安全性

3.1 数据加密技术

vmess利用了对称加密和非对称加密技术,确保用户数据的隐私与安全,其中:

  • 对称加密:发送和接收双方都使用相同的密钥进行加解密,确保数据安全。
  • 非对称加密:通常用于密钥交换,终端间的密钥交换只需实现信道不变,提升安全性。
    这意味着即使数据传输的线路被窃听,内容也无法被轻易解读。

3.2 认证与会话管理

vmess协议通过 session_id、user_id及header中的其它信息来进行认证,确保连接的合法性。这进一步提高了协议的安全性,防止未授权的用户访问数据。

3.3 防止恶意攻击

  • 防止中间人攻击:vmess协议能够有效地防止MITM(中间人攻击),通过数据加密和验证机制来保证通信安全。
  • 跨平台安全:支持多平台使用,降低因平台差异造成的安全漏洞。

4. vmess在实际应用中的优势

  • 灵活配置:用户可以根据需求设定不同的加密方式和连接方式,增加访问安全;
  • 高匿名性:隐藏用户真实IP,提高上网隐蔽性;
  • 易于扩展:支持多种插件,提供额外的功能以增强安全性。

5. vmess协议的局限性

尽管vmess具备很多优越的安全特性,但也有其局限性:

  • 仍然需要性能较好的服务器支持,否则会影响使用体验;
  • 由于是基于V2Ray协议的实现,存在配置复杂、用户学习成本较高的问题。
  • 对某些复杂的检测机制可能无效,不能100%保证匿名性。

6. 结论

综上所述,vmess协议在数据加密、认证机制和安全防护等方面表现出色,其设计理念旨在提高用户上网的安全性与隐私保护。尽管存在一定的局限性,例如使用体验和学习成本,依然是一个相对安全的选择。

7. 常见问题解答(FAQ)

Q1: vmess协议安全吗?

A1: 是的,vmess协议具有多种加密技术和严格的认证机制,能够有效保护用户的个人隐私和数据安全,是相对较安全的网络协议。

Q2: 如何配置vmess协议?

A2: vmess协议的配置相对较复杂,需要用户按照我们的指南一步一步操作,通常需要配置加密算法、服务器地址以及认证参数。

Q3: vmess与其他协议相比有什么优势?

A3: 相较于其他网络协议,vmess协议在加密方式上更加灵活、高效,具备良好的伪装性与匿名性,对抗网络审查和封锁能力更强。

Q4: 有没有推荐的vmess客户端?

A4: 有许多优秀的sdk与app支持vmess协议,例如V2Ray、Shadowsocks但建议根据平台(如Windows、macOS或Linux)选择合适的客户端。

Q5: 即使使用了vmess协议,是否还存在风险?

A5: 任何技术都有其局限性,即使使用vmess协议,用户仍需注意其他施工。如防病毒软件、防火墙设置等后续的网络安全保护。

通过对vmess协议的全面分析,希望能帮助用户更好地理解和使用这一协议,为他们提供一份安全的上网体验。

正文完
 0